If you’re eager to lend your vision to the network’s strategic direction, consider running for a seat on AHP’s Board of Managers, the governing body whose members are elected to represent the interests of providers and to make the major decisions facing AHP.

Nominations are now being accepted for four board seats: the Highland Hospital affiliated PCP seat, Strong Memorial Hospital affiliated Specialist seat and the At-Large Specialist and PCP seats. (The at large seats represent physicians affiliated with Jones, Noyes, Arnot, St. James, and Wyoming County hospitals). The terms of the current Managers in these positions expire in December 2018, so elections for these seats are planned for late October.

Eligible physicians interested in joining the Board of Managers are encouraged to nominate themselves to run for their constituency’s board seat. To nominate yourself, submit a personal statement to Renée Sutton that includes information about your experience or interest in population health and clinical integration, as well as any experience serving on an AHP committee.
